孫陽
遼寧錦州渤海大學工學院
基于單片機的住宅防盜防火報警系統設計
孫陽
遼寧錦州渤海大學工學院
本文設計的防盜系統此外還實現了通過秘密進行驗證的過程,類似于系統的登錄,當輸入用戶名和密碼的時候,只有用戶名和密碼正確,系統的驗證就通過,用戶才有權限成功登錄系統。在本文的控制系統部分,當輸入密碼時,系統會根據數據中的密碼數據信息進行比對,當密碼是正確的時候,控制系統就會成功登錄進去,而且密碼是可以進行更改的。此外系統中功能實現部分還包括了自動診斷是否掉線,以及處理掉電情況,從而最后提高系統的穩定性。同時系統實現了可靠性強的特點,這是通過系統的抗干擾設計實現的。隨著社會的發展,人們生活水平的提高,人們在生活質量方面提出了很大的要求。
防盜系統 探測器 單片機 智能報警
隨著現代社會的不斷發展以及現代信息技術以及計算機技術的不斷發展,人們逐漸進入了一個信息化的時代,這個時代的很多的產品都已經實現了智能化,無論是生活還是工作,人們提出的要求越來越高,很多的智能化產品均出現人們的眼前,比如儀表實現了智能化,很多的家電也實現了智能化,智能化汽車也是極容易見到的,目前的很多小區也實現了智能化管理,所有事物的改變充分說明了時代的進步以及社會的科技技術的突飛猛進。隨著智能化以及數字化的不斷進步,我們的生活中幾乎處處可以看到的以及感受到智能化的存在,智能化已經成為了社會未來發展的一種必然的趨勢。
本文設計的住宅防盜防火報警系統,產生的背景是智能化住宅的興起以及飛速的發展,住宅實現智能化這是用戶在對人身安全以及財產安全的重要體現,本論文就是結合了用戶的需求從而設計了該系統。本文的住宅防盜防火報警系的第一個重要的目標就是增強住宅的安全性以及可靠性。而這些指標是否可以達標需要考慮到住宅小區的類型以及住宅小區如何進行使用和如果發生了意外的風險該采取什么樣的措施進行補救。接著再通過傳感器進行分險的探測,通過單片機進行系統的控制,此外在數據的安全性方面用到了通訊等技術,最終保證了小區用戶的人身安全以及財產安全。
系統的組成部件是由用戶端探測器、自動報警器組成的,而且在設計部分采用了模塊化的思想,這樣可以增強系統的界面美觀以及功能的便捷。作為住宅建筑的智能化,住宅智能化是其發展的重要趨勢。目前在智能方面的產品主要包括了智能防盜以及智能防火防盜報警系統,但是目前針對集合防火防盜功能的實現的產品不是很多,而且開發這些產品的成本相對而言會比較高,運用的技術也涉及到多種,開發這種新型的智能警報系統對我們的生活有著重要的現實意義。系統的總體功主要是由用戶端探測器、自動報警器、以及密碼驗證等組成的。
其中防火的探測器選擇的是溫度探測器以及CO探測器組成的一種復合的探測器,這對于火災的防御有著很大的意義;而防盜的探測器選擇的是微波探測器以及紅外探測器。本文的住宅防盜防火報警系統的總體框架圖如圖1所示。

圖1 住宅防盜防火報警系統總體框架圖
本系統總電路圖如圖2所示。

圖2 住宅防盜防火報警系統總電路圖
2.1 自動報警器總體電路設計
本文的自動報警器電路中的組成部件有電源設計,密碼顯示以及探測器。自動報警器組成框圖如圖3所示。

圖3 用戶端自動報警器組成框圖
自動報警器總體電路設計部分的時鐘電路是由電容和晶振組成的,而這里的電容的大小選擇的是30P,晶振頻率是12MHz。其中的復位電路的組成部件主要有電阻、二極管以及電容、開關組成。報警信息的采集是通過單片機以及傳感器連接實現的。
2.2 用戶探測器的設計
探測器的電路包括了兩種分別是防盜電路和防火探測器電路。通過采用多種類型的傳感器從而完成了多元信號的檢測,這個思路是探測電路中的最普遍的思路,通過多元的信號進行綜合的檢測除了能夠實現實時監測盜情以及火情之外還能夠進一步減少探測器的錯誤率,這對系統的可靠性以及抗干擾性都有著很大的提高。
2.3 防火探測器設計
本系統在防火探測器部分用到的探測器是溫度探測器以及一氧化碳的探測器形成的一種復合型的探測器,這種復合型的探測器大大降低了傳統探測器誤報率,使得探測火災更加可靠。
2.4 煙霧傳感器設計
MQ-2A型半導體器敏作為一種錫類半導體的相關元件,檢測時所選擇的檢測物是有敏感度的SNO2,這是用來制成煙霧所需要的材料。氣體不同時相應的靈敏度也會不一樣,煙霧傳感器的設計用來進行室內環境的檢測是十分有必要的。設計的電路圖如圖4所示。

圖4 煙霧傳感器連接圖
用戶端的自動報警器在進行軟件設計的時候用到了模塊化的思想,該自動報警器設計模塊是由密碼驗證以及鍵盤輸入和主控模塊組成的??刂颇K程序設計的主控流程圖如圖5示。

圖5 主控流程圖
其中的單片機的P3.2引腳是連接著防盜的傳感器,而單片機的P3.3引腳是連接著防火傳感器,所以,但有災情出現的時候,系統就會自動的變成密碼啟動的子程序,假如輸入密碼的時候,系統驗證是正確的,那么報警就會自動取消,如果密碼輸入時錯誤的,那么報警程序會觸發中斷,進入到中斷服務子程序,有災情出現的話,那么該地址7FH就會設置成1,接著就會按照險情的種類進行劃分,比如7EH表示的是盜情的相關情況,而7DH表示的是火警的標志位。在進行主程序運行的時候,最初需要做的是判斷出探頭和電源各自所處的狀態,當所有的條件都準備好了之后,程序就等著產生中斷。當進行檢測的時候,如果中斷的標志位是1的話,那么就會啟動調密碼顯示子程序,當密碼是正確的時候系統會再一次進行中斷信號的檢測,當密碼是錯誤的時候就會主程序就會進行7EH的判斷,如果7EH的話,那么控制報警模塊就會被調用,接著記錄相關的警報信息,從而就可以判斷出火災是否發生了,火災的發生與否是取決于7DH的值是多少。
隨著小區實現智能化的構想的不斷發展,智能小區已經不斷引起了人們的關注,智能小區充分說明了智能化已經在國際社會中取得重大的發展。這也是作為21世紀關于住宅的一種新概念的解讀。
本文主要是圍繞著住宅防盜防火報警系統進行展開,相比較于傳統的防火防盜系統,本文系統的區別充分體現了智能化,而且防火功能結合防盜功能從而使得檢測火情的同時可以監測盜情,最終實現系統報警自動化功能。火情功能的是現實與與溫度探測器以及光電感煙探測器密不可分的,而盜情功能的實現是與微波探測器以及紅外探測器聯系在一起的,將這些探測器都集合到一個探測器中形成復合式的探測器。而一旦出現了火情或者是盜情的時候,終端申請就會發送到單片機,然后來自控制電路中就會發出警報。
[1]王芳,林蔚,王長清,等.住宅防盜防火智能電話報警系統設計[J].河南師范大學學報:自然科學版,2004,32(3):121-123
[2]謝衛華,宋蟄存.基于單片機的家庭智能防火防盜系統的設計[J]. 機電產品開發與創新, 2009, 22(6):148-149
[3]郭華, 張文霞,劉愛軍.基于單片機的多傳感器集成式防火防盜報警器[J]. 科技創新導報, 2015(23):72-73
[4]張守武,周波.基于STC89C52的智能防盜防火報警系統設計[J]. 實驗室研究與探索,2016, 35(6)